The 600S1R8BT250T is a high-performance ceramic multilayer capacitor (MLCC) manufactured by ATC (American Technical Ceramics). It is specifically designed for demanding RF and microwave applications where high reliability, stability, and low losses are critical. This capacitor features a high Q factor and low equivalent series resistance (ESR), making it suitable for use in high-frequency circuits, filters, and matching networks. Its rugged construction ensures reliable performance in harsh environments.

Additional Details
The 600S1R8BT250T has a capacitance of 1.8 pF. It features a voltage rating suitable for many RF and microwave applications. The temperature coefficient of capacitance is very low, ensuring capacitance stability over temperature. ATC MLCCs are known for their high reliability and are often used in critical applications where component failure could have significant consequences. Its small size allows for use in densely populated circuit boards. This component is often deployed in impedance matching, filtering, and decoupling scenarios. The capacitor's high self-resonant frequency guarantees it will behave capacitively across a broad range of frequencies. Consult the part's datasheet to determine specific tolerances and voltage ratings for particular applications.
